Monitoring the dissolved oxygen content with the installation of aeration units at Upper Lake of Bhopal

The present study is undertaken to evaluate the impact of aeration units on the physicochemical characteristics of Upper Lake situated in Bhopal. The lake receives a large amount of sewage from its densely populated habitation. The continuous input of biologically active nutrients (phosphates and nitrates) through inflow of sewage has changes the water body into eutrophic lake resulting frequent oxygen depletion. The installation of aeration units have been found to have significant in increasing the oxygen concentrations, changing the species diversity besides reducing the pathogenic microbial population.
